2 - In addition, your Realtor can help you with finance. Buying a home usually requires financing. Since agents work with lenders on a daily basis, they can be your shortcut to finding a reliable representatives of the home loan. They know those with a successful track history of closing loans with no fire drills. Based on your specific needs, the requirement for at least two recommendations from the Mortgage Bankers.

5 - Everyone understands buying a home is an emotional decision, but it is important to know the facts too. Your agent has access to the most recent comparable sales, how long the property market, and information about the area. It would be a shame not to use her expertise.

6 - On the same lines, if you work closely with the agent it can alert you to the property that just came on the market or maybe it's about to be listed. Leave no question in mind your Realtor that you intend to only work with it. Your loyalty will be rewarded.

7 - Real estate professionals are well versed in the Seller Disclosure reports and can help you wade through the detailed disclosure by sellers. This form is designed to detect defects on the desirability of the home and neighborhood. Your agent sees the publication of a routine so be sure to request assistance.

8 - For real estate agents to see so many houses they can also be a source of advice on redecorating, renovating, remodeling or individual houses. We all tend to spend money on upgrades that could provide little or no return. View property through the eyes of a Realtor plan for value added improvements to the house.
